Product Overview

The ABB PM590-ARCNET (1SAP150000R0261) represents the high-performance tier of the modular AC500 PLC platform. Designed for complex, time-critical automation tasks, this CPU features a dedicated ARCNET interface to facilitate deterministic networking across large-scale industrial systems. With a massive 2MB user program memory and a lightning-fast processing time of 0.002 µs per instruction, it coordinates extensive I/O clusters and high-speed synchronized processes. Technical Specifications

The PM590-ARCNET optimizes system throughput via high-density memory and rapid logic execution:

  • Processor Type: AC500 High-Performance CPU

  • User Program Memory: 2 MB

  • Total Storage Capacity: 5120 kB

  • User Data Memory: RAM-based architecture

  • Controller Processing Time: 0.000002 ms (0.002 µs) per instruction

  • Integrated Interfaces: ARCNET, 2x RS232/485 (Configurable), 1x FieldBusPlug (FBP)

  • Display: Integrated Monochrome LCD for local diagnostics

  • Rated Voltage: 24 V DC (Range: 20.4 – 28.8 V DC)

  • Protection Rating: IP20

  • Net Dimensions: 67.5 mm (W) x 76 mm (H) x 62 mm (D)

  • Net Weight: 0.157 kg

Engineering Advantages

  • Ultra-Fast Deterministic Processing: An instruction execution time of 0.002 µs places this CPU at the top of its class. This responsiveness eliminates scan-time bottlenecks, allowing for the precise control of high-speed packaging lines, turbine controls, and complex multi-axis motion.

  • Dedicated ARCNET Networking: The on-board ARCNET interface provides a deterministic, token-passing network environment. This architecture prevents data collisions and ensures consistent communication timing, which is essential for synchronized distributed control across multiple PLC nodes.

  • Massive Memory Headroom: 2MB of program memory and 5MB of total storage accommodate the most demanding application projects. This capacity handles extensive data logging, large-scale recipe management, and complex user-defined libraries without requiring external memory modules.

  • Multi-Port Serial Versatility: Two independent RS232/485 ports allow for simultaneous communication with diverse field devices. Engineers configure these ports to manage Modbus RTU, ASCII, or proprietary serial protocols while maintaining the primary network backbone via ARCNET.

  • Direct Local Diagnostics: The integrated LCD provides real-time access to error codes, system status, and firmware versions. This local interface enables maintenance staff to identify hardware or network faults instantly at the cabinet rail without requiring a laptop connection.

FAQs

  • Does the PM590-ARCNET require a specific Terminal Base? Yes. You must install the PM590-ARCNET on a compatible ABB AC500 Terminal Base (such as the TB5xx series). The terminal base manages the 24V DC power distribution and provides the physical terminals for the ARCNET and serial connections.

  • What is the benefit of ARCNET over standard Ethernet in this context? ARCNET offers a deterministic communication protocol that is highly resistant to industrial noise. In systems requiring fixed, repeatable response times across many nodes, ARCNET provides predictable performance that standard, non-switched Ethernet may lack.

  • Can I expand the I/O count of this CPU? The PM590-ARCNET supports the full range of S500 expansion modules. You simply attach digital, analog, or specialty I/O modules to the local bus of the terminal base to increase your field-level signal count.

  • How does the FieldBusPlug (FBP) port enhance the system? The FBP interface allows this CPU to bridge into other fieldbus environments like PROFIBUS DP or CANopen using the appropriate external plug. This flexibility ensures the PM590-ARCNET remains compatible with various plant-wide networking standards.
